Here we have a 429 mile trip that features 2 games in Minneapolis and St. Paul, 3 games in and around Milwaukee, and 3 games in Chicago. Also because it’s a 5ish hour drive between Milwaukee and Minneapolis, a travel day has been baked into most trips.
This is one of our less drivey trips, and reducing the amount of time you spend in the cars means you can enjoy the cities until right before the first pitch.
